As for HPLC, the pump delivers the cellular section at a managed flow charge(a). Air can certainly dissolve within the cellular phase beneath the typical atmospheric pressure through which we are now living in. In the event the cell phase includes air bubbles and enters the supply pump, difficulties like stream level fluctuations and baseline noise/drift may possibly manifest. The degassing device assists avert this difficulty by removing air bubbles inside the cell phase(b). After the dissolved air has become taken off, the cell section is delivered to the column.
